What is a Drag Chain?


Before delving into the specifics of the 10x20 drag chain, it's important to understand what a drag chain is. Essentially, it’s a flexible conduit that is used to manage the movement of cables and hoses in machinery. They are especially useful in applications where there is a repetitive motion, such as in robotics, CNC machinery, and assembly lines. By keeping the cables organized and protected, drag chains help prevent wear and tear that can result from continuous motion.


Features of the 10x20 Drag Chain


The 10x20 designation refers to the internal dimensions of the drag chain's cross-section, measuring 10 mm in width and 20 mm in height. These dimensions make it suitable for a range of applications where space is at a premium but sufficient volume is required to house multiple cables or hoses. The 10x20 model is often praised for its lightweight yet sturdy design, which allows for easy installation and seamless integration into existing systems.


One of the key features of the 10x20 drag chain is its modularity. The chains can be connected in a series, allowing for custom lengths to accommodate specific machinery setups. This flexibility means that the 10x20 model can be utilized in both large industrial applications and smaller machinery without the need for extensive modifications.

The 10x20 drag chain is particularly popular in CNC machines, automated production lines, and robotic systems where precision and reliability are key. In these settings, cables are often subjected to harsh conditions, including frequent movement and exposure to dust, oil, and other contaminants. The 10x20 drag chain’s protective design ensures that the cables remain intact and functional over time.


Additionally, this drag chain is used in various other contexts such as


1. 3D Printers In 3D printing, the movement of the print head requires a well-managed system of cables. The 10x20 drag chain provides the necessary support while preventing tangles.


2. Conveyor Systems In material handling, conveyor belts equipped with drag chains facilitate smooth operation as they support electrical and pneumatic hoses.


3. Stage Equipment In the entertainment industry, the 10x20 drag chain is used to manage audio and lighting equipment cables, keeping the stage area organized and safe.
